> as posted here earlier[1], Apple has tightened notarization requirements this 
> year making it impossible for current R releases to be notarized until R 
> 4.0.0 and thus the last Apple-notarized release is R 3.6.2.
> 
> If you are on a macOS version that doesn't require notarization, then I have 
> put a binary that is not notarized in
> https://mac.R-project.org/bin/macosx/el-capitan/base/R-3.6.3.nn.pkg
> SHA1(R-3.6.3.nn.pkg)= c462c9b1f9b45d778f05b8d9aa25a9123b3557c4
> 
> I am currently investigating if we can enable the required restrictions on 
> binaries and what implications for the functionality of R that will have and 
> will keep you posted.
